3 Circuits Separate Slip Ring Precious Metal Contact Compatible With Data Bus Protocols
Description
An electrical slip ring is a device used to transfer power and data from a stationary to a rotating structure. Slip rings can provide continuous or intermittent rotation while transmitting power and data - simplifying operation, improving application performance, and eliminating the risk of damage to wiring between movable parts.
The LPS019-0210 separate slip ring is a customized unit that uses precious metal contacts at the rotary interface. Color-coded lead wires are used on both the stator and rotor for simplifying electrical connections.

Specifications | |
Operating Speed | 0-100 rpm |
Number of Circuits | 2 |
Voltage | 48 VAC/DC |
Current Rating | 10A |
Temperature Range | -55℃ to +70℃ |
Working Humidity | 60%RH or higher |
Contact Material | Precious metal |
Lead Size | 17 # silver plated copper |
Lead Length | Standard 250 mm (9.843inch) |
Dielectric Strength | ≥500 VAC @50Hz, between each circuit |
Body Material | Precious metal |
Insulation Resistance | 1000 MΩ @ 500 VDC |
Electrical Noise | 1 mΩMin |
